Path Lights

Path lights are designed to illuminate walkways, driveways, and garden paths, enhancing safety and aesthetics in both residential and commercial settings. These fixtures are typically low-profile and come in various styles to suit different landscapes. When purchasing path lights, buyers should consider the brightness (measured in lumens), energy efficiency (preferably LED), and durability against weather conditions. The ease of installation is also a key factor, as many options are designed for straightforward DIY setups.

Spot Lights

Spot lights offer a focused beam of light, making them ideal for highlighting specific features such as trees, sculptures, or architectural elements. They are commonly used in gardens and commercial spaces to create dramatic effects. B2B buyers should evaluate the beam angle and adjustability of the fixtures, as these factors influence how effectively the lights can showcase particular areas. Additionally, considering the material and finish is important for long-term durability and aesthetic integration.

Flood Lights

Flood lights provide a broad beam of light, making them suitable for illuminating large areas such as sports fields, parking lots, or outdoor events. They are known for their powerful output and extensive coverage. B2B buyers should assess the wattage and lumens output to ensure adequate brightness for their specific applications. Energy consumption is also a critical consideration, as more powerful flood lights can lead to higher operational costs. Opting for energy-efficient LED models can mitigate this issue while providing ample illumination.

Well Lights

Well lights, or in-ground fixtures, are designed to be installed flush with the ground, providing subtle illumination for plants, pathways, or patios. They are particularly effective in enhancing the aesthetics of landscaping without obstructing views. For B2B buyers, installation complexity and the potential need for professional help should be considered, as well as the fixture’s water resistance and durability. Choosing well lights with adjustable brightness can also add versatility to their use.

String Lights

String lights are a popular choice for adding a decorative touch to outdoor spaces, making them ideal for events, patios, and dining areas. They come in various styles and can be easily strung between trees or along fences. When sourcing string lights, buyers should focus on durability, especially if they are to be used outdoors. The power source (solar vs. electric) and the ease of installation are also essential factors. While they provide an attractive ambiance, buyers should be aware of their relatively lower durability compared to more robust lighting options.

Strategic Material Selection Guide for low voltage landscaping lighting

When selecting materials for low voltage landscaping lighting, it is essential to consider their properties, advantages, disadvantages, and how they align with international standards and buyer preferences. Below is an analysis of four common materials used in this application.

1. Polycarbonate

Key Properties: Polycarbonate is known for its high impact resistance and excellent clarity. It has a temperature rating of -40°C to 120°C and is resistant to UV radiation, making it suitable for outdoor applications.

Pros & Cons: The durability of polycarbonate makes it ideal for outdoor lighting fixtures. It is lightweight and cost-effective compared to glass. However, it can be prone to scratching and may degrade over time when exposed to harsh environmental conditions.

Impact on Application: Polycarbonate is compatible with various lighting technologies, including LED, and can be molded into complex shapes, allowing for innovative designs. It also provides good light diffusion.

Considerations for International Buyers: Buyers should ensure that polycarbonate products meet regional compliance standards such as ASTM in the U.S. or DIN in Germany. The material’s recyclability may also be a factor for environmentally conscious markets in Europe.

2. Aluminum

Key Properties: Aluminum is lightweight, corrosion-resistant, and has a melting point of around 660°C. It is often anodized for enhanced durability and aesthetic appeal.

Pros & Cons: The key advantage of aluminum is its strength-to-weight ratio, making it suitable for various fixture designs. It is relatively easy to manufacture and can be extruded into complex shapes. However, aluminum can be more expensive than other materials and may require additional coatings to enhance corrosion resistance in coastal areas.

Impact on Application: Aluminum fixtures can withstand varying weather conditions, making them ideal for outdoor use. They are compatible with low voltage systems and can effectively dissipate heat generated by lighting elements.

Considerations for International Buyers: Compliance with standards such as JIS in Japan or EN in Europe is crucial. Buyers should also consider the availability of aluminum in their region, as sourcing can vary significantly.

3. Stainless Steel

Key Properties: Stainless steel offers excellent corrosion resistance, with a temperature tolerance that can exceed 800°C. It is known for its strength and durability.

Pros & Cons: The primary advantage of stainless steel is its longevity and resistance to rust, making it suitable for harsh environments. However, it is heavier and more expensive than aluminum, and its manufacturing process can be complex.

Impact on Application: Stainless steel is particularly effective in coastal regions where saltwater can cause corrosion. Its aesthetic appeal makes it a popular choice for high-end landscaping projects.

Considerations for International Buyers: Buyers need to ensure that the stainless steel used meets specific grades (e.g., 304 or 316) based on local environmental conditions. Compliance with international standards, such as ASTM, is also essential.

4. Glass

Key Properties: Glass is known for its excellent optical clarity and ability to withstand high temperatures. It is non-reactive and can be treated for UV resistance.

Pros & Cons: Glass provides a premium look and can enhance the lighting effect. However, it is fragile and can break easily, making it less suitable for high-traffic areas. The manufacturing process can also be more complex, leading to higher costs.

Impact on Application: Glass is often used in decorative fixtures and can enhance the aesthetic appeal of landscaping lighting. It is compatible with various lighting technologies, including LED.

Considerations for International Buyers: Buyers should be aware of the fragility of glass and consider local regulations regarding safety standards. In regions with high humidity, glass may require special coatings to prevent fogging.

Manufacturing Processes

The manufacturing of low voltage landscaping lighting is typically divided into four main stages: material preparation, forming, assembly, and finishing. Each stage involves specific techniques and considerations that are vital for producing high-quality products.

1. Material Preparation

Selection of Materials:
The first step involves selecting high-grade materials that withstand outdoor elements. Common materials include aluminum, stainless steel, and durable plastics, which provide corrosion resistance and longevity.

Material Testing:
Before production begins, materials undergo rigorous testing to ensure they meet specifications for strength, durability, and electrical conductivity. This may involve mechanical testing and environmental simulations.

2. Forming

Molding and Extrusion:
In this stage, materials are shaped into components using techniques such as injection molding for plastic parts or extrusion for aluminum components. This ensures that each part is manufactured to precise specifications.

Quality Checks:
During the forming process, manufacturers implement in-process quality checks (IPQC) to monitor dimensions and tolerances. This minimizes defects early in production, reducing waste and costs.

3. Assembly

Component Integration:
Once all parts are formed, they are assembled using automated and manual processes. This may involve soldering, wiring, and installing LED modules, ensuring that all components are compatible and function as intended.

Testing for Functionality:
After assembly, products undergo functionality tests to ensure they operate correctly under low voltage conditions. This step is crucial for identifying any electrical issues before the final product is packaged.

4. Finishing

Surface Treatment:
The finishing stage often includes anodizing or powder coating to enhance corrosion resistance and aesthetic appeal. This process is vital for outdoor products that face harsh environmental conditions.

Final Quality Control:
The final quality control (FQC) step involves comprehensive inspections and tests to ensure that the products meet all specifications and standards before shipping. This includes visual inspections and electrical safety tests.

QC Checkpoints

Incoming Quality Control (IQC):
Before materials enter production, IQC checks ensure that all incoming components meet specified standards. This is critical for preventing defects in the final product.

In-Process Quality Control (IPQC):
During manufacturing, IPQC involves continuous monitoring of production processes. This includes regular checks on dimensions, electrical performance, and assembly quality to catch issues early.

Final Quality Control (FQC):
FQC encompasses final inspections and testing before products are packaged. This includes functional tests, safety checks, and visual inspections to ensure that every item meets quality standards.

Common Testing Methods

Various testing methods are employed throughout the manufacturing process to guarantee product quality:

  • Electrical Testing: Ensures that all electrical components function correctly under specified voltage conditions.
  • Environmental Testing: Simulates outdoor conditions, including temperature extremes and moisture exposure, to assess durability.
  • Safety Testing: Verifies compliance with safety standards, including short circuit tests and insulation resistance checks.

Comprehensive Cost and Pricing Analysis for low voltage landscaping lighting Sourcing

When sourcing low voltage landscaping lighting, understanding the cost structure and pricing dynamics is crucial for international B2B buyers. This analysis breaks down the components that contribute to the overall costs and highlights the factors that can influence pricing, providing actionable insights for effective procurement.

Cost Components

  1. Materials: The primary cost driver in low voltage lighting is the raw materials used, including LED bulbs, wiring, fixtures, and housings. The choice of materials significantly impacts both durability and performance, making it essential for buyers to assess material quality against their project requirements.

  2. Labor: Labor costs encompass both direct and indirect expenses associated with the manufacturing process. This includes wages for assembly workers and skilled technicians who ensure quality control. Labor costs can vary considerably based on the region; for example, manufacturing in regions with lower labor costs may yield savings.

  3. Manufacturing Overhead: This includes costs related to the factory operation, such as utilities, maintenance, and administrative expenses. Efficient manufacturing processes can help minimize overhead costs, which is a critical consideration for buyers looking for competitive pricing.

  4. Tooling: Tooling costs refer to the expenses incurred for the equipment and tools necessary for production. Custom tooling can be expensive but may be justified for large orders or specialized products. Buyers should inquire about these costs, especially when considering custom designs.

  5. Quality Control (QC): Ensuring product quality is essential, and QC costs should not be overlooked. This includes testing materials and finished products to meet safety and performance standards. Buyers should look for suppliers that prioritize QC to reduce the risk of defects.

  6. Logistics: Transportation and shipping costs can significantly affect the total cost, particularly for international buyers. Factors such as shipping method, distance, and customs duties need to be carefully evaluated. Incoterms can play a crucial role in determining responsibility for these costs.

  7. Margin: The profit margin that suppliers add to their costs can vary based on market conditions and the competitive landscape. Buyers should understand the average margins in the industry to better negotiate pricing.

Price Influencers

  • Volume/MOQ: The minimum order quantity (MOQ) can significantly influence pricing. Higher volumes typically lead to lower per-unit costs due to economies of scale. Buyers should assess their needs and negotiate for better rates based on anticipated volume.

  • Specifications/Customization: Customized products often come with higher costs due to additional design and production efforts. Buyers should balance the need for customization with budget constraints.

  • Materials and Quality Certifications: The choice of materials and certifications (such as CE marking or ISO standards) can affect pricing. Higher-quality materials and certifications usually command higher prices but can lead to lower maintenance costs over time.

  • Supplier Factors: The reputation and reliability of suppliers can influence pricing. Established suppliers may charge a premium for their proven track record, while newer entrants might offer lower prices to gain market share.

  • Incoterms: Understanding the implications of different Incoterms is vital for cost management. Terms like FOB (Free on Board) and CIF (Cost, Insurance, and Freight) can significantly affect pricing and responsibility for shipping costs.

Buyer Tips

  • Negotiation: Always approach negotiations with a clear understanding of the cost structure and market pricing. Leverage volume commitments and long-term partnerships to negotiate better terms.

  • Cost-Efficiency: Consider the Total Cost of Ownership (TCO), which includes not just the initial purchase price but also maintenance, energy consumption, and potential replacement costs. Investing in higher-quality products may yield savings in the long run.

  • Pricing Nuances: International buyers should be aware of currency fluctuations, tariffs, and local market conditions that can affect pricing. It is advisable to build relationships with local suppliers who understand regional dynamics.

Essential Technical Properties and Trade Terminology for low voltage landscaping lighting

When sourcing low voltage landscaping lighting, understanding the technical properties and trade terminology is essential for making informed purchasing decisions. Below are key specifications and terms that B2B buyers should be familiar with.

Key Technical Properties

  1. Material Grade
    Definition: This refers to the quality of materials used in the construction of lighting fixtures, including metals, plastics, and glass.
    Importance: Higher material grades ensure durability and resistance to environmental factors such as moisture and corrosion, which is particularly important in outdoor settings. Buyers should evaluate material grades to ensure longevity and reduce maintenance costs.

  2. Voltage Rating
    Definition: This indicates the maximum voltage the lighting system can handle safely, typically around 12 to 24 volts for low voltage systems.
    Importance: Understanding voltage ratings is crucial for compatibility with existing electrical systems and for ensuring safety. Incorrect voltage can lead to system failures or hazards, making it essential to match products with the intended installation environment.

  3. Wattage
    Definition: Wattage measures the amount of energy consumed by the lighting fixture, impacting brightness and energy efficiency.
    Importance: Buyers must consider wattage to balance desired illumination levels with energy consumption. Lower wattage fixtures can reduce operational costs and energy use, appealing to environmentally conscious buyers.

  4. IP Rating (Ingress Protection)
    Definition: This rating indicates the level of protection against dust and water ingress, typically denoted as IP followed by two digits (e.g., IP65).
    Importance: A higher IP rating is crucial for outdoor lighting, ensuring the fixtures can withstand weather conditions. Buyers should select fixtures with appropriate IP ratings for their specific geographical conditions to avoid premature failure.

  5. Lumen Output
    Definition: Lumen output measures the total amount of visible light emitted by a fixture.
    Importance: Understanding lumen output helps buyers determine how bright a lighting solution will be, allowing for better planning in landscape illumination. This is particularly important for creating ambiance or safety in outdoor spaces.

Common Trade Terms

  1. OEM (Original Equipment Manufacturer)
    Definition: A company that produces parts or equipment that may be marketed by another manufacturer.
    Significance: Knowing about OEMs is vital for buyers looking to source reliable products. Collaborating with reputable OEMs can lead to enhanced product quality and better warranty terms.

  2. MOQ (Minimum Order Quantity)
    Definition: The smallest quantity of a product that a supplier is willing to sell.
    Significance: Understanding MOQ is essential for budget management and inventory control. Buyers need to align their purchase volumes with their project requirements to avoid excess stock or supply shortages.

  3. RFQ (Request for Quotation)
    Definition: A document sent to suppliers requesting pricing and other terms for specific products.
    Significance: Utilizing RFQs allows buyers to compare prices and terms from multiple suppliers, fostering competitive pricing and better negotiation outcomes. This is particularly useful in international markets where price variations may occur.

  4. Incoterms (International Commercial Terms)
    Definition: A set of predefined international trade terms that clarify the responsibilities of buyers and sellers in shipping goods.
    Significance: Familiarity with Incoterms is crucial for international buyers to understand shipping responsibilities, risks, and costs. This knowledge helps in avoiding disputes and ensuring smooth transactions across borders.

  5. Dimming Capability
    Definition: The ability of a lighting fixture to adjust brightness levels.
    Significance: Dimming capability enhances flexibility in lighting design and energy efficiency. Buyers should consider this feature for applications requiring adjustable lighting, such as events or residential settings.

Brief Evolution/History

The evolution of low voltage landscaping lighting can be traced back to the early 20th century when outdoor lighting was primarily limited to gas lamps. The introduction of electric lighting revolutionized outdoor aesthetics, but it was not until the late 1970s that low voltage systems became commercially viable. These systems offered a safer, more energy-efficient alternative, making them increasingly popular among residential and commercial property owners.

Over the years, technological advancements have further transformed the sector, with innovations such as LED technology dramatically improving energy efficiency and lifespan. Frequently Asked Questions (FAQs) for B2B Buyers of low voltage landscaping lighting

  1. How do I vet suppliers for low voltage landscaping lighting?
    Vetting suppliers is crucial for ensuring quality and reliability. Begin by researching potential suppliers’ backgrounds, checking their business licenses and certifications. Look for reviews and testimonials from previous clients, particularly in your region. Utilize platforms like Alibaba or Global Sources to find verified suppliers, and consider requesting references. Additionally, assess their production capabilities and experience in your specific market to gauge their reliability in meeting your requirements.

  2. Can I customize my low voltage landscaping lighting products?
    Yes, many suppliers offer customization options for low voltage landscaping lighting. Discuss your specific needs regarding design, materials, and functionality with potential suppliers. It’s advisable to request prototypes or samples to evaluate quality before placing a bulk order. Ensure that you clearly communicate your specifications and deadlines. Keep in mind that customization may affect lead times and pricing, so clarify these aspects upfront to avoid misunderstandings.

  3. What are the typical minimum order quantities (MOQ) and lead times?
    Minimum order quantities vary by supplier and can range from a few dozen to several hundred units. Smaller suppliers may have lower MOQs, while larger manufacturers often set higher thresholds. Lead times can also differ based on the complexity of the order, customization requests, and supplier capacity. Generally, expect lead times of 4 to 12 weeks. Always confirm these details during your negotiations to ensure they align with your project timelines.

  4. What payment methods are recommended for international transactions?
    For international transactions, it’s best to use secure payment methods like letters of credit, PayPal, or escrow services to protect your investment. These methods provide a level of security and recourse should issues arise. Be cautious with wire transfers, as they can be difficult to trace and recover in case of disputes. Establish clear payment terms and conditions in your contract to avoid misunderstandings and ensure a smooth transaction.

  5. What quality assurance (QA) certifications should I look for?
    Look for suppliers that hold relevant quality assurance certifications such as ISO 9001, CE marking, or RoHS compliance, as these indicate adherence to international quality standards. Inquire about their QA processes, including testing methods and inspection protocols, to ensure that their products meet your specifications. Request documentation of certifications and test results for transparency. This diligence can significantly reduce the risk of receiving substandard products.

  6. How can I manage logistics and shipping for my orders?
    Effective logistics management is critical for timely delivery. Work closely with your supplier to understand their shipping options and timelines. Consider using a freight forwarder who specializes in international shipping to handle customs clearance and other complexities. Make sure to discuss incoterms (like FOB, CIF) to clarify responsibilities regarding shipping costs and risks. Also, factor in potential delays due to customs, especially in regions with stringent import regulations.
